Output 31bf4b141d731df1abd656936f6767ec23f3d78ccd9e6c69106adcdae2ea746a:1

value
1085757904
script pubkey
OP_0 OP_PUSHBYTES_20 e5cd0a394f6786be9246073f18e54e42a7d08467
address
bc1quhxs5w20v7rtayjxqul33e2wg2nappr83hqjsa
transaction
31bf4b141d731df1abd656936f6767ec23f3d78ccd9e6c69106adcdae2ea746a
confirmations
1051
spent
true